Edwin Silva: Trump stands for hatred and division

No matter what is said against Donald Trump, it will not sway voters who made up their minds to side with him come November.

His hateful rhetoric? Music to their ears. History has a tendency to repeat itself. Hitler demonized the Jewish people, rounded them up and quite literally railroaded millions to their deaths. Thus far, Trump has stated he would love to ship out millions of Mexicans. Forced labor, i.e., the wall. Check. Uproot and destroy families? Check.

Recognize and realize what Donald Trump stands for: Hate-mongering, dividing our country along color and gender lines. If I can only convince two voters to pick Hillary Clinton, it would make me one happy camper.

Edwin Silva, Modesto
